QueryBuilder<TResponse> constructor

const QueryBuilder<TResponse>({
  1. required IQuery<TResponse> query,
  2. required Widget builder(
    1. BuildContext context,
    2. TResponse response
    ),
  3. bool? cacheUntilChanged,
  4. void onError(
    1. BuildContext context,
    2. Object error,
    3. StackTrace stackTrace
    )?,
  5. void onResponseReceived(
    1. BuildContext context,
    2. TResponse response
    )?,
  6. Widget errorBuilder(
    1. BuildContext context,
    2. Object error,
    3. StackTrace stackTrace
    )?,
  7. Widget waiterBuilder(
    1. BuildContext context
    )?,
  8. List<Stream<IEvent>>? eventObservers,
  9. Key? key,
})

Implementation

const QueryBuilder({
  required IQuery<TResponse> query,
  required super.builder,
  super.cacheUntilChanged,
  super.onError,
  super.onResponseReceived,
  super.errorBuilder,
  super.waiterBuilder,
  super.eventObservers,
  super.key,
}) : super(action: query);